Water Heater Burst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small leak in a single room Yes No DIY is usually fine for small, contained leaks.
Large leak affecting multiple rooms No Yes A large leak need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.
Hidden moisture or structural damage No Yes Hidden moisture or structural dam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to detect and address.
Highly contaminated water No Yes Highly contaminated water need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.

Water Heater Burst Water Removal Cost in Fort Oglethorpe, GA

The cost of water heater burst water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Fort Oglethorpe, GA. Our team will provide you with a detailed estimate after conducting an on-site assessment.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Water Extraction $500-$2,500 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000-$5,000 Size of affected area and type of equipment needed
Repairs and Reconstruction $2,000-$10,000 Scope of repairs and materials needed

Common Questions About Water Heater Burst Water Removal

How Long Does Water Heater Burst Water Removal Take?

Our team works efficiently to ensure that the water removal and restoration process is completed as quickly as possible. On average, it takes 3-5 days to complete the process, but this can v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.

Is Water Heater Burst Water Removal Covered by Insurance?

Yes, water heater burst water removal is typically covered by insurance, but the specifics can vary depending on your policy and the circumstances of the incident. Our team can help you navigate the claims process and ensure that you receive the compensation you deserve.

Can I Prevent Water Heater Burst Water Removal?

Yes, there are steps you can take to prevent water heater burst water removal. Regular maintenance, such as checking the temperature and pressure relief valve, can help prevent bursts.
